4. HIPAA & Therapy‑Related Privacy

If you become a therapy client, any information you share in sessions or through the client portal is protected under HIPAA. This website does not store or transmit protected health information (PHI).

All clinical communication occurs through my secure, HIPAA‑compliant portal, SimplePractice.

Email Security & HIPAA‑Aligned Encryption

My business email is encrypted in transit and at rest using SecureMyEmail, which provides HIPAA‑aligned technical safeguards. Email is not intended for sharing PHI. Please avoid including personal health details in email; all clinical communication will be redirected to the secure portal.
